Pride Weekend Recap & Photo Dump

This weekend was the 2012 Utah Pride Festival in Salt Lake City.  I spent the entire weekend volunteering for Cause for Paws Utah, and I have to say I prefer volunteering to attending.  It was much more fun hanging out and talking to people in our booth than the half hour I would have walked around and gotten bored.  It made me happy.

We also lost a dog... Lilo bolted from her cage and took off.  We chased her but no one could catch her as she ran right out the gate across a busy street and away.  Josh chased her several blocks before he lost her.  Luckily a very nice lady found her the next day and brought her to the Salt Lake County Animal Services booth and we got her back!
